Page 72 of Daizenshuu 4: World Guide maps the Afterlife's geography, focusing on the Serpent Road (Snakeway), which spans 1 million kilometers between King Yemma's Castle and King Kai's planet. This entry, located within the "Places Apart from Earth" section, details that Goku took six months to travel the path initially, but only 1.5 days to return.
